Introduction
Ignacio Halley is an accomplished inventor based in Miami, FL (US). He has made significant contributions to the field of smart tolling systems, holding a total of 2 patents. His work focuses on utilizing advanced technologies to enhance the efficiency and accuracy of toll collection processes.
Latest Patents
One of Ignacio Halley's latest patents is a smart tolling system that employs computer vision and machine learning techniques. This innovative system automatically tracks and monitors vehicles across multiple video streams captured by a networked camera assembly. The system derives comprehensive vehicle trajectories by stitching together detections of each vehicle from various video feeds using multi-object tracking algorithms. These trajectories enable the correlation of different events triggered by vehicles at multiple roadside devices, such as cameras and radars. By mapping the trajectories in space and time, the system can associate seemingly fragmented events and synthesize complete vehicle profiles. This is particularly useful when certain events may have missed capturing some vehicle information due to obstructions or other factors. The trajectory-based event correlation enhances tolling accuracy by minimizing revenue leakage from missed or incomplete vehicle data in congested traffic conditions.
